## Runbook: Cartoquill Catalog Cache

Catalog edits publish invalidation events; edge caches purge within 30s. If stale products persist, check the purge queue depth before anything else. Manual full flush is last resort — it hammers origin for ~10 minutes. Partial flush by category is safer. Verify the invalidation worker is running with the expected configuration values, listed below.

deployment values, yadup-kadug:
[sorys]
port = 5672
team = noveth
host = sorys.orvexcorp.example
region = south-4
access_code = ac_deddc1
timeout_ms = 1500

Facilities Ticket — Cleaning Crew Access, Brindle Annex

For new starters handling evening lock-up: the Sorano Cleaning crew arrives nightly at 21:30 via the annex side door. Check their rota sheet, note arrival in the log, and ensure the storeroom is relocked afterward. To let them through the side door, enter the access code below.

badge for yaweg-hafog: bdg-GX-6

## Support

Clock skew between Forgeline build agents can cause signed artifacts to be rejected and cache keys to miss. All agents sync against the internal Timberwell time service; drift beyond 500 ms triggers automatic quarantine of the agent. If a release is blocked by skew-related signing failures, check the Timberwell status page first, then contact the build infrastructure team.

escalation mailbox, bafog-fafog: ulador@paliqlabs.internal

Welcome aboard. Digestella assembles and schedules the nightly email digests for all Pondermill workspaces. The scheduler runs under the `svc-digestella` account, which may enqueue batches, read template metadata, and write to the send-audit table — nothing else. Please never reuse this account for ad-hoc scripts; request a personal sandbox account instead. Credentials rotate every 60 days through the Vaultline job. When configuring a local scheduler instance, authenticate using the key shown below.

service key, fawip-bajef: kto11_Qt5wZK9vdNC